I agreed completely with "that .....". I have tried to use ISC a few times
with no success.
I was using TSM WEB Interface 5.2, which was announced by IBM as a temporary
solution for TSM 5.3, with TSM 5.4 and TSM 5.5 successfully. I addition, I am
using command line interface dsmadmc.
I wonder, is there any possibility to install TSM WEB Interface 5.2 with TSM
6.1 or not?
